About the UGC'3 info meeting
In the Social Impact edition of the Urban Greenhouse Challenge, we challenge you to develop an urban farming site that significantly improves the quality of life of local residents in one of the most diverse lower-income neighbourhoods of Washington D.C. Come up with a comprehensive plan to develop East Capitol Urban Farm (Washington, D.C.) into an attractive urban farming site that enables robust and resilient year-round sustainable food production. The Challenge is open to students from universities and universities of applied sciences worldwide, in all phases of their studies (BSc, MSc, PhD or equivalent).
